Abstract

This paper uses statistical data reporting economic and social indicators in Primorsky Krai and the city of Vladivostok to assess the potential success of the 2012 Russian federal investments to the region in anticipation of the 2012 Asia Pacific Economic Cooperation Conference. This paper concludes that although the investments may have short term benefits, sustained long term economic growth will only be possible if extensive economic reforms are taken to ease entry into the local markets.
